Houston-area hospital employee fired after cameras found in bathrooms

THE WOODLANDS, Texas — An employee at the Memorial Hermann Medical Center in The Woodlands was recently fired after hospital officials said a recording device was found in a staff bathroom.

“While performing routine maintenance, the construction team discovered a recording device that had been installed in the staff, single-stall, unisex bathroom on the second floor, just outside the West Tower,” an internal notice to employees said.

KHOU 11 News obtained copies of the notice via current employees, which appeared to be sent by hospital leadership. In the internal communications, hospital officials said security was alerted and the device was immediately removed…
